HC Deb 30 September 1909 vol 11 cc1420-1
Mr. JAMES O'CONNOR

asked the Chief Secretary to the Lord Lieutenant of Ireland whether he is aware that, about a year ago, the Estates Commissioners noted 41 applications from evicted tenants in the county Wicklow as suitable to be provided with holdings; and can he say how many of these 41 applicants have since been provided with holdings?

Mr. BIRRELL

The Estates Commissioners inform me that 19 county Wicklow evicted tenants have been reinstated or provided with new holdings by them, and six by landlords, and that 21 others have been noted for consideration in the allotment of untenanted land in respect of which purchase proceedings are pending before the Commissioners.

The HON. MEMBER

also asked the Chief Secretary whether the Estates Commissioners have purchased, or are negotiating for the purchase of, the Saunders Grove estate, at Baltinglass, county Wicklow; and, if so, whether the Estates Commissioners propose to sell to John Lee the farm on the Saunders estate from which he was evicted two years ago?

Mr. BIRRELL

The Estates Commissioners had a preliminary inspection made of part of this estate with the consent of the late owner, but the present owner is not willing to sell, and no proceedings are now pending for the sale of the estate. The Commissioners received an application from John Lee for reinstatement in a holding from which, according to his statement, he was evicted in June, 1907. The holding is now in the occupation of Thomas Lee. The application does not come within the provisions of the Evicted Tenants Act, and the Commissioners have decided to take no action in the matter.
